The year 2000 marked a massive shift in the history of Malayalam cinema with the release of the low-budget movie . Directed by R. J. Prasad and starring the iconic Shakeela , this movie single-handedly pioneered a commercial wave known as the Shakeela Tharangam (Shakeela Wave). Made on a meager budget of ₹12 lakh, the film went on to gross an astonishing ₹4 crore.
